Home window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ged windows and installing new, modern units that improve the appearance and functionality of a property. This process typically includes assessing the existing window openings, selecting suitable replacement options, and carefully installing the new windows to ensure a proper fit. The goal is to enhance energy efficiency, increase curb appeal, and improve the overall comfort of the home. Local contractors experienced in window replacement can guide homeowners through the selection process and ensure the work is completed to high standards.

This service helps address a variety of common problems homeowners face with their existing windows. Old or damaged windows may lead to drafts, making heating and cooling less effective and increasing energy costs. Windows that are cracked, warped, or have broken seals can also compromise security and allow moisture or pests to enter. Additionally, outdated windows may no longer match the style of the home or may be difficult to operate, impacting daily convenience. Replacing these windows can resolve these issues and provide a more secure, energy-efficient, and visually appealing solution.

The overview below groups typical Home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Portland, ME.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window replacements, such as installing a single window or fixing a broken pane,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on window size and materials.

Standard Full Replacement - Replacing multiple windows with standard models usually costs between $3,000 and $8,000 for a typical home. Local contractors often handle these projects efficiently within this range, though larger homes may see higher costs.

Custom and Energy-Efficient Windows - Upgrading to custom-sized or high-efficiency windows can range from $8,000 to $15,000 or more. These projects tend to be less common but are often valued for long-term savings and enhanced aesthetics.

Larger or Complex Projects - Extensive window replacements involving multiple stories, historic preservation, or specialty materials can reach $15,000+ in costs. Such projects are less frequent and often involve additional considerations that influence pricing.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
